The QuantiGene Plex Human Akt Signaling Pathway Panel, 12-plex, enables measurement of expression of relevant human genes associated with the Akt signaling pathway through the analysis of 12 RNA targets and housekeeping genes in a single well using Luminex xMAP technology in combination with branched DNA signal amplification. This panel contains genes that are involved in signaling pathway dynamics and this pathway’s role in cellular processes such as cell survival, proliferation, metabolism, and apoptosis.

QuantiGene Plex panels are extensively tested for target combinability, interference, and cross-reactivity to provide the outstanding levels of validation and precision.

This panel is used in combination with the QuantiGene Plex Assay Kit, which contains all buffers, plates, and detection reagents necessary to perform the assay in 96-well plates.

Features of QuantiGene Plex panels include:

  • True multiplexing—measure multiple genes of interest and housekeeping genes in the same well with no cross-reactivity
  • Accommodation of difficult sample types—works with degraded and cross-linked RNA in FFPE tissues and blood
  • Standardized platform—uses 96-plate format compatible with Luminex 200, FLEXMAP 3D, and INTELLIFLEX systems (384-well format available on demand)
  • Simple workflow—employs an ELISA-like workflow with direct hybridization of transcripts to beads and transcript labeling (branched DNA signal amplification and PE readout)
  • Customize with validated targets—if alternative targets are needed in this panel, select from our large inventory of over 22,000 genes to create custom research panels
  • Rapid turnaround of this catalog panel for fast delivery

Targets: IGF1R, IRS1, AKT1, AKT1S1, GSK3B, MTOR, RPS6KB1, CREB1, GAPDH, HPRT1, PPIB, GUSB

Panel and signal amplification technology

QuantiGene Plex assays are hybridization-based assays for the direct quantitation of RNA directly from cell lysates, tissue homogenates, or purified RNA, and they enable the measurement of multiple targets in the same well via multiplexing. QuantiGene Plex panels contain two components: a target-specific probe set and magnetic capture beads. The target-specific probes are used to capture the RNA of interest, and branched DNA technology then amplifies the fluorescent signals, which are read with a Luminex xMAP instrument. The intensity of the fluorescent signal is directly proportional to the amount of target mRNA present in the sample. This allows for (relative) quantification of gene expression and, with this specific panel, enables human immune profiling. Detailed and step-by-step data analysis is facilitated by the QuantiGene Plex data analysis app.

Applications

QuantiGene Plex assay research applications include compound screening of drug candidates, biomarker verification, siRNA knockdown efficiency determination, prospective and/or retrospective analysis of clinical samples, microarray validation, predictive toxicology research, and translocation/fusion gene detection. In general, any multiplex gene expression analysis can be done with QuantiGene Plex assays, independent of species or sample type.

Contents & Storage

Target-specific probe set and magnetic capture beads (premixed and ready to use) to run one 96-well plate.
Store probe set at -20°C and capture beads at 4°C (do not freeze).
